Some children are playing card games. If each of them is given 8 cards, there will be 11 cards left. If each of them is given 5 cards, there will be 29 cards left.
- How many children are there?
- How many cards are there?
(a)
Number of extra cards for the children
= 29 - 11
= 18
Number of extra cards for each child
= 8 - 5
= 3
Number of children
= 18 ÷ 3
= 6
(b)
Number of cards
= 8 x 6 + 11
= 48 + 11
= 59
Answer(s): (a) 6; (b) 59
